Understanding Psychiatric Hospital Care

Psychiatric hospital services can seem intimidating, but it's designed to provide specialized support for individuals experiencing serious mental health conditions. This type of place typically involves constant monitoring from a group of trained professionals, including psychiatrists, registered nurses, and psychologists. Patients may obtain a range of interventions, including medication management, one-on-one treatment, and collective sessions. Ultimately, the objective is to manage problems, promote well-being, and create coping strategies for long-term mental wellness.

Navigating Psychiatric Hospital Admission

Facing a emotional hospital admission can be stressful and confusing for both the person and their kin. It's crucial psychiatric hospital to grasp the process, which often begins with a referral from a practitioner or crisis team. Frequently, this stems from concerns about safety, either for the person's own protection or the protection of others. The institution will then conduct an evaluation to establish the requirement for inpatient care. The individual may have few control over this initial stage, but it's important to get clarification regarding the reasons for the suggestion and understand your entitlements.

Life After a Psychiatric Hospital Stay

Re-entering daily life after a psychiatric facility stay can be tough. Many individuals experience a combination of sentiments, including gratitude to be back , alongside anxiety about re-integrating to their former routines and responsibilities . It can be crucial to establish a reliable network of friends and professionals to help with persistent treatment and to tackle any lingering concerns . Directing on manageable goals and practicing wellness are important steps towards healing .
